OEM vs. Aftermarket Exterior Parts
When shopping for Dodge Ram Cooling Parts Ram outside components, purchasers invariably face a choice in between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) parts and Aftermarket parts. Comprehending the pros and cons of each helps in making an informed purchasing choice.
OEM Parts
OEM parts are manufactured straight by Ram (or Mopar) to exact factory specs.
- Pros: Perfect fitment guaranteed, maintains factory warranty, preserves original vehicle worth.
- Cons: Generally more expensive, minimal styling options compared to the aftermarket.
Aftermarket Parts
Aftermarket parts are produced by third-party manufacturers.
- Pros: Vast variety of styles, often more budget-friendly, frequently provide efficiency upgrades beyond factory specs (e.g., brighter LEDs, thicker steel).
- Cons: Quality can differ substantially in between brands; fitment might periodically require small modifications.
Tips for Maintaining Dodge Ram Exterior Parts
Investing in quality exterior parts is just half the battle; appropriate maintenance ensures they last for the life time of the truck.
- Wash Regularly: Salt, dirt, and brake dust are the main enemies of exterior metal and paint. Wash the truck bi-weekly, paying unique attention to the wheel wells and undercarriage.
- Safeguard Chrome and Stainless Steel: Use devoted metal polishes to prevent pitting and rust on chrome bumpers, side steps, and trim pieces.
- Condition Plastics: Fender flares and plastic trim can fade under the UV rays of the sun. Apply a quality UV protectant or trim conservator to keep them looking deep black and flexible.
- Examine Seals and Weatherstripping: Check the seals around tonneau covers, windows, and doors every year to prevent water leaks into the cabin or truck bed.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Are Dodge Ram outside parts interchangeable across different design years?
A: Generally, no. Outside measurements, grille shapes, and body lines alter considerably between generations (e.g., 4th Generation 2009-- 2018 vs. 5th Generation 2019-- Present). Always verify the specific year, make, model, and taxi setup before buying parts.
Q2: Do aftermarket fender flares need drilling into the truck body?
A: It depends upon the specific design. Numerous modern-day fender flares use existing factory mounting holes and secure with clips, requiring no drilling. However, durable or pocket-style flares may require minor drilling into the underside of the wheel well lip for protected installation.
Q3: How do tonneau covers assist with fuel economy?
A: Without a cover, an open truck bed develops a pocket of unstable air (drag) as the automobile moves on, requiring the engine to work more difficult. A tonneau cover ravels the air flow over the back of the truck, resulting in a small boost in highway fuel effectiveness.

Q4: Can I install Dodge Ram outside parts myself, or should I hire a professional?
A: Many exterior elements-- such as tonneau covers, running boards, bug guards, and replacement grilles-- are designed for simple DIY setup using fundamental hand tools. Nevertheless, much heavier parts like steel replacement bumpers, winches, or complicated electrical lighting upgrades might require expert installation.
